In 2021, transportation goods were one of the top 5 export categories from Pakistan to Azerbaijan, totaling $2.529 million. This category includes vehicles, aircraft, and parts, showcasing the strong demand for transportation equipment in Azerbaijan. The significant value of exports in this category highlights the importance of Pakistan's transportation industry in global trade.
Exports in transportation goods are crucial for Pakistan's economy as they generate significant revenue and support the growth of the manufacturing sector. The main regions in Pakistan where these goods are produced include Karachi, Lahore, and Sialkot, which are major industrial hubs. These regions have well-established infrastructure and skilled labor force, making them ideal for the production of transportation equipment.
These goods are important for import into Azerbaijan as they help meet the growing demand for transportation equipment in the country. The regions in Azerbaijan where these goods are supplied include Baku, Ganja, and Sumqayit, which are key commercial centers. The imports of transportation goods from Pakistan contribute to the development of Azerbaijan's transportation infrastructure and support its economic growth.

The main product groups exported from Pakistan to Azerbaijan include textiles, machinery, chemicals, food products, and mineral fuels. Textiles have been a consistent export item, reflecting Pakistan's strong textile industry. Machinery exports have also shown steady growth, indicating Azerbaijan's demand for industrial equipment. Chemicals and food products are also significant exports, showcasing Pakistan's diverse manufacturing capabilities. Mineral fuels, such as oil and gas, are crucial exports for Azerbaijan, meeting the country's energy needs. Overall, the trade between Pakistan and Azerbaijan is diversified, with various product groups contributing to the bilateral trade relationship.
- Karachi Port: Karachi Port is the largest and busiest seaport in Pakistan, handling about 60% of the nation's cargo. It is located in Karachi, which is the financial and industrial capital of Pakistan. The port has both a commercial and container terminal, making it a crucial hub for trade in the region.
- Port Qasim: Port Qasim is the second largest port in Pakistan, situated near Karachi. It primarily serves as a container port and is equipped with modern facilities to handle a large volume of cargo. Port Qasim plays a significant role in the import and export activities of the country.
- Gwadar Port: Gwadar Port is a deep-sea port located in the southwestern province of Balochistan. It is strategically positioned at the crossroads of international trade routes, making it a vital port for transshipment and trade with Central Asian countries. Gwadar Port is expected to play a key role in the development of the China-Pakistan Economic Corridor (CPEC).

Baku Port: Baku Port is the largest and busiest port in Azerbaijan, located on the western shore of the Caspian Sea. It serves as a major hub for both commercial and container shipping in the region. The port handles a wide range of cargo including oil, gas, construction materials, and general goods. Baku Port is equipped with modern facilities and infrastructure to handle large vessels and has a storage capacity of over 15 million tons. It plays a crucial role in facilitating trade between Azerbaijan and other countries, particularly those in Europe and Asia.
In addition to Baku Port, there are several other important ports in Azerbaijan including:
Sumgayit Port: Situated on the Absheron Peninsula, Sumgayit Port is a key maritime gateway for the transportation of bulk cargo such as chemicals, grains, and fertilizers. The port has modern facilities for loading and unloading cargo and plays a significant role in the country's industrial and economic development.
Alat Port: Located near Baku, Alat Port is a strategic hub for container shipping and logistics in Azerbaijan. The port has state-of-the-art container terminals and warehousing facilities, making it a major transit point for cargo moving between Europe and Asia. Alat Port is connected to the national railway network, providing seamless transportation links for goods moving to and from the port.
Lagan Port: Lagan Port is a smaller port located on the Caspian Sea coast, primarily handling fishing vessels and small cargo ships. The port serves the local fishing industry and also plays a role in supporting the region's tourism sector, as it is a popular destination for recreational boating and water sports.
Astara Port: Situated on the border with Iran, Astara Port is an important link for trade between Azerbaijan and its southern neighbor. The port handles a variety of goods including oil, agricultural products, and consumer goods. Astara Port is part of the North-South Transport Corridor, a key transit route connecting Russia, Iran, and India.
Neftchala Port: Neftchala Port is a small port on the Caspian Sea coast, primarily used for the transportation of oil and gas products. The port supports the country's energy sector by providing a vital link for the export of petroleum products to international markets.

The average transit time for sea freight from Pakistan to Azerbaijan can vary depending on several factors. On average, a shipment by sea from Pakistan to Azerbaijan can take anywhere between 15-30 days. This time frame is influenced by the distance between the two countries, as well as logistical considerations such as the availability of shipping vessels, weather conditions, and potential port congestion. Additionally, the choice of shipping route and carrier can also impact transit times. Some routes may be more direct and efficient, resulting in shorter shipping times, while others may involve multiple stops or transfers, extending the overall journey.
Customs clearance is another important aspect that can affect the overall shipping time from Pakistan to Azerbaijan. Both countries have specific customs regulations and procedures that must be followed, which can sometimes lead to delays in processing and clearance. On average, customs clearance in Pakistan can take about 1-2 days, while in Azerbaijan, it may take around 2-3 days. These delays can add to the total shipping time, so it is important for shippers to factor them into their planning.
